Chris,
The kit below is just right for the Europa.  Put the aluminum on the 
inside.  I have used other mat insulations and covered it in stainless 
sheet.  I'm really proud of the stainless one but at three days of 
cutting and fitting, I don't recommend it for those who want to save 
time.  This kit allows you to put the 4 pieces in (2 sides, top and 
back).  Put the back in first, then cut the sides and top.  Ted Coberly 
of Flight Crafters showed me a trick of cutting the sheets 1/2 inch 
longer where they butt and then trim off the insulation and aluminum 
---From the back where it overlaps and then wrapping the corners from the 
sides and top.  Takes a lot more time and planning, but is pretty, and 
well sealed. Cut your stainless and make smooth round transitions from 
the hole to the fuselage bottom and cover the edges to show off your 
craftsmanship.
